Range hood fans market dynamics

DRIVER

" Increasing demand for effective kitchen ventilation and healthier indoor air."

Cooking produces heat, moisture, grease particles, odors, smoke, and combustion-related pollutants, making ventilation essential in residential and commercial kitchens. Indoor-air concerns influence approximately 58% of Range Hood Fans Market purchases, while odor removal affects 61%. Residential ventilation guidance commonly recommends at least 100 cubic feet per minute for an intermittently operated kitchen fan. Premium models exceed 1,000 cubic feet per minute for heavy cooking and large gas appliances. More than 131 million occupied housing units in the United States create replacement demand, while apartment construction across Asia supports first-time installations. Kitchen remodeling influences approximately 63% of sales. Properly ducted hoods remove contaminated air outdoors, while recirculating models use activated-carbon filters where external ducting is unavailable.

RESTRAINT

" Complex installation requirements and limited access to external ducting."

Installation complexity affects approximately 39% of potential buyers. Ducted range hoods require suitable wall, roof, or ceiling routes, along with correctly sized ducts and outdoor terminations. Ducting limitations influence 34% of purchasing decisions, particularly in apartments and older buildings. Island hoods need ceiling-mounted support and longer ductwork, increasing project complexity by approximately 30% compared with under-cabinet products. Powerful models exceeding 400 cubic feet per minute may require make-up air under certain building codes to prevent excessive indoor depressurization. Noise concerns affect 31% of users because poorly sized ducts, multiple bends, and high fan speeds increase sound. Professional installation requirements influence 22% of purchases, while restricted kitchen space affects 26% of urban households.

CHALLENGE

" Balancing airflow performance, noise, capture efficiency, and compact design."

Higher airflow does not automatically provide better ventilation when hood dimensions, mounting height, duct diameter, and fan noise are poorly matched. A standard residential hood may provide 300 cubic feet per minute, while heavy-duty cooking can require more than 700 cubic feet per minute. Increasing airflow can raise noise above 6 sones and discourage regular use. Recommended quiet-performance specifications target no more than 3 sones at airflow of at least 100 cubic feet per minute. Manufacturers must fit motors, filters, lights, sensors, controls, and ducts into products measuring approximately 30 inches or 36 inches wide. Slim under-cabinet designs can save 60% of cabinet space, but reduced internal volume complicates airflow management. Maintaining filtration above 95% while controlling noise and pressure remains technically demanding.

BY TYPE

Island Hood: Island hoods account for approximately 20% of the Range Hood Fans Market. These products are suspended from the ceiling above cooktops installed within kitchen islands. Premium residential renovations generate nearly 71% of island hood demand, while restaurants and demonstration kitchens contribute 29%. Island models generally require greater capture coverage because airflow can approach the hood from 4 sides. Common products measure 36 inches or 42 inches wide and provide approximately 600 cubic feet per minute. Open-concept kitchens influence 49% of premium island hood purchases. Adjustable suspension systems accommodate ceilings exceeding 9 feet. Key features include stainless steel construction, glass canopies, 4 fan speeds, LED lighting, remote controls, and dishwasher-safe filters.

Wall-chimney Hood: Wall-chimney hoods lead the global Range Hood Fans Market with approximately 40% share. These models mount directly above wall-positioned cooktops and use a visible chimney enclosure for ducting. Residential installations generate approximately 82% of demand, while commercial and semi-commercial kitchens represent 18%. Typical widths include 30 inches and 36 inches, with airflow commonly reaching 600 cubic feet per minute. Premium products provide boost modes above 1,000 cubic feet per minute. Wall-chimney hoods are selected by approximately 57% of premium buyers seeking a visible design feature. Smart versions integrate 3-speed controls, automatic vapor detection, dimmable LEDs, and app connectivity. Perimeter aspiration can improve capture behavior while reducing perceived noise.

Under-cabinet Hood: Under-cabinet hoods account for approximately 31% of global demand and nearly 37% of United States sales. These products mount beneath existing cabinets, making them suitable for apartments, compact kitchens, and replacement projects. Installation generally requires fewer structural modifications than island products, reducing completion time by approximately 25%. Standard widths include 24 inches, 30 inches, and 36 inches. Basic units offer around 200 cubic feet per minute, while premium models reach 1,100 cubic feet per minute. Ultra-slim designs can recover approximately 60% of cabinet storage. Convertible products support ducted and recirculating configurations, while advanced units offer 9 speed settings, 42-decibel operation, motion controls, brushless motors, and 3-times stronger odor filtration.
